Department of Information and Marketing Sciences
Qualifications
BCom/BSc/BTech in Information Systems/Data Science/Information Technology or related area with at least a 2.1 degree class
MSc/MPhil in Information Systems/Data Science/Information Technology or related area
A PhD in Information Systems/Data Science/Information Technology or a related area is an added advantage
Teaching experience at the tertiary level is an added advantage
Duties & Responsibilities
The candidate must be capable of supervising both undergraduate and postgraduate students’ research work, assess students on Work Related Learning and must be able to teach the following modules at the undergraduate level;
Data and Statistical Analysis;
Programming;
Databases;
Data Science
